There’s No I In Team

Emphasising that teamwork prioritises the collective good and requires collaboration over individual goals, the well-known phrase “There’s No I in Team” strongly suggests that individual team members should put aside their personal ambitions and work together towards a shared objective, rather than focusing on individual achievements.  This type of positive Team mentality is crucial when it comes to individuals working together for the good of a business, whether that’s in the Retail Industry, the Commercial Industry, the Building Industry or the Entertainment Industry.
